The reason there were far fewer cases of the flu as well as RSV in 2020 and 2021 was due to measures adopted to slow the spread of the virus that causes COVID-19, such as handwashing and social distancing. These viruses are transmitted in much the same way as SARS-CoV-2. https://www.factcheck.org/2023/04/scicheck-fewer-cases-of-flu-due-to-pandemic-precautions-contrary-to-viral-claim/ https://www.scientificamerican.com/article/flu-has-disappeared-worldwide-during-the-covid-pandemic1/ https://www.hsph.harvard.edu/news/hsph-in-the-news/a-sharp-drop-in-flu-cases-during-covid-19-pandemic/
